WebFeb 17, 2024 · House Bill 7065 (HB 7065) unanimously passed the Florida House late Wednesday evening, seeking to enact a wide-ranging series of measures to promote father engagement in the lives of children and prioritize resources through the Department of Children and Families (DCF) to help current and former foster system children. WebApr 11, 2024 · Brittany Bernstein. Florida governor Ron DeSantis signed a bill on Monday to invest $70 million in programs that support involved fatherhood in the state.
